Hyderabad, August 24th, 2025: The spectacular natural fitness extravaganza, Deccan Uprising 2025, hosted by ICN (iCompete Natural), the world’s leading federation for Natural Fitness Modelling, received unprecedented response and set a record as the largest competition of the year among the 70 odd hosted across the globe. The two-day action-packed event, powered by Presenting Partner Wellversed, concluded today at the SR Classic Convention Centre, Shamshabad.

Over 400 athletes from across India and abroad, spanning diverse age groups and categories, vied for the honours at the high-octane competition in bodybuilding, fitfashion, fitness modelling, and transformation challenges. Tollywood heartthrob Allu Sirish, a passionate advocate of natural fitness, charmed the contenders and the audience, by gracing the competition as a special guest.

About ICN

Founded in Australia in 1991 by Wayne McDonald, ICN (iCompete Natural) is the world’s largest federation for drug-free fitness and bodybuilding, with a presence in over 90 countries and a community of more than 30,000 athletes. With its motto “Commitment to Drug-Free Competition”, ICN is synonymous with fairness, integrity, and opportunity in fitness modelling and bodybuilding.

About ICN India

ICN India is among the fastest-growing natural fitness federations globally, with an expanding presence in Bengaluru, Goa, Hyderabad, Delhi, Mumbai, Chennai, Surat, and more cities. It has pioneered unique categories such as the Moms Division and plans to introduce Kids Competitions, broadening access to fitness culture.
